Released POWs Speak Well of Erstwhile Captors
P/Insp. Rex Cuntapay and PO1
Marvin Agasen both used to view the communist-led New People’s Army (NPA)
in a bad light. Captured last Jan. 3 together with PO1 Alberto Umali after
their unit’s encounter with guerrillas belonging to the NPA’s Narciso
Antazo Aramil Command (NAAC), which operates in Rizal (a province
southeast of Manila), they were held as prisoners of war (POWs) for almost
three months. They were released on March 27, very near the place where
they were captured. The three policemen had only kind words to say about
their former custodians. |
